Revolutionary Material: Flexible Slate SKIN MicroStone
Flexible Slate SKIN MicroStone breaks the boundaries of traditional stone applications. With a thickness of just 0.05 mm - 0.1 mm, this ultra-flexible material redefines what you know about natural stone, offering warmth, lightness, and adaptability.
Advantages and Benefits
The MicroStone is the thinnest and most flexible stone in the world. It is lightweight, making it easy to handle and install, and can be applied to a variety of surfaces, including walls, furniture, and fixtures. Its flexibility allows it to conform to complex shapes, opening up endless design possibilities.
Key Features
This slate is available in a stunning Silver Shine color with a riven surface finish, providing a unique aesthetic appeal. Each sheet measures 210 x 105 cm and weighs only 1.1918 kg, making it suitable for diverse applications. The sheets are reinforced with a thin material, such as cotton yarn, during manufacturing, ensuring durability without compromising flexibility.
Recommended Uses
Ideal for interior wall cladding, this versatile material can be used in kitchens, living rooms, and other interior spaces. It is perfect for creative projects like cladding furniture, cabinets, walkways, bars, and even decorative elements like lamps or flower stands.
Installation Tips
Handling and installing MicroStone sheets is straightforward. They can be easily cut and shaped to fit your design needs, and their light weight simplifies transportation and installation. The sheets are delivered directly to your location for convenience.
Maintenance and Care
Maintaining the beauty of Flexible Slate SKIN MicroStone requires minimal effort. Regular cleaning with a damp cloth is usually sufficient to keep its surface looking pristine. Avoid using harsh chemicals that could damage the finish.
